Phoenixville Nurse Recognized for Above-and-Beyond Care of Patient and His Dog

Phoenixville Hospital nurse Michelle Lombardi was recognized by Philadelphia Magazine and won a Daisy award.

Phoenixville Hospital ICU Nurse Michelle Lombardi was recently honored on Philadelphia Magazine’s 2024 Best of Philly list as “Best Foster Parent,” writes Justin Heinze for Patch.

Lombardi’s patient was living out of his car and faced a dilemma when he had to spend an extended period in the hospital. He didn’t know what would happen to his dog.

Demonstrating remarkable empathy, Lombardi obtained permission from the patient and took the dog into her own home, caring for it as if it were her own pet.

During this time, she was also part of the medical team that nursed the patient back to health. The patient expressed immense gratitude towards Lombardi, not only for her medical care but also for her kindness in looking after his dog.

Her dedication continued until the patient recovered, secured an apartment, and could reunite with his pet. For her extraordinary compassion, Lombardi was awarded a Daisy award, recognizing her exceptional service and care. This award is part of a national program that seeks to acknowledge above-and-beyond work from nurses.
